Opinion Summary: E.M.D. Sales, Inc. v. Carrera | Date Decided: 1/15/25 | Case No. 23-217
The question presented in this case is: Whether the burden of proof that employers must satisfy to demonstrate the applicability of an FLSA exemption is a mere preponderance of the evidence-as six circuits hold-or clear and convincing evidence, as the Fourth Circuit alone holds.
The Supreme Court held: The preponderance of the evidence standard applies when an emÂployer seeks to demonstrate that an employee is exempt from the minimum-wage and overtime-pay provisions of the FLSA.
